Benton County supervisors approved Resolution 25-63 to hire Cheyenne Packer as a full-time communications specialist in the sheriff's office. The position was presented as a replacement for an employee identified in the record only as Paige, who recently resigned.
A motion to approve employment was made and the board voted in favor. County staff said the hire is by resolution and the department head and county personnel will complete the required paperwork.
Supervisors recorded their assent by voice vote; staff will proceed with onboarding and payroll actions for Packer.
